Some words about Ven. Thubten Chodron:
Ven. Thubten Chodron grew up in the USA and graduated with a BA in history and later post-graduated as a teacher. In 1975, she attended a meditation course given by Lama Thubten Yeshe and Kyabje Lama Zopa Rinpoche and felt drawn to Buddhism. In 1977 she received novice ordination and in 1986 the full ordination (bhikshuni) in Taiwan. She founded the monastery Sravasti Abbey (in the state of Washington, USA), of which she is abbess. Ven. Thubten Chodron travels worldwide to teach the Dharma. Moreover, she is co-author with H.H. Dalai Lama of the ten-volume series of “The Library of Wisdom and Compassion”.
